Choosing uPVC Sash Windows

If you are looking to purchase upvc sash windows for your home There are a lot of things to consider. You need to make sure that the product you purchase is strong beautiful, attractive, and easy to maintain.

Modern contrasts with. traditional

You may want to replace the windows made of wood by more modern ones if are looking to renovate. Sash windows are a common design in traditional homes and can provide a feel of a past time to your property.

Typically, sash windows come with two sashes, one fixed, and the other that slides out. This system allows for ventilation and security without compromising the look and feel of the window. The timber material that is natural can become brittle and can lead to water penetration.

Modern sash windows are constructed from uPVC which is easier to maintain and more resistant to weather. These products also come with a 10 year guarantee, meaning that you won't need to fret about repairs or replacements in the future.

Sash windows have been used for a long time, and you'll find them in many homes which include Victorian and Edwardian homes. They're an excellent option for period inspired homes however they are also great for modern homes.

Sash windows also have the advantage of being easy to fix. You can easily dismantle the movable sashes to clean and repairs. Modern sash windows come with spring balance systems that counters gravity. This means that you don't need to be concerned about heavy counterweights made of metal or catch mechanisms.

Traditional styles are still being used in many homes However, they began to lose their appeal in the 1960s. Many homeowners have replaced their old sash windows with fittings made of casement.

Traditional wooden sash windows aren't only expensive to replace, but they can also be prone to rot or insects. A replacement of high-quality must be made of the same wood species as the originals and be finished with a suitable coating.

Foiling can be applied to sash windows for enhancing their appearance. Foiling will give your windows the appearance of freshly painted windows and give them a more polished appearance. It also stops the flaking of the paintwork that is a common occurrence.

U-PVC is also more robust than timber, and has a higher energy retention capacity. This allows you to reduce your energy usage.

Cost-effective alternative to timber

There are a variety of options when you're considering replacing your windows. These include uPVC or timber. These can enhance the appearance and function of your house. You should also consider the security and energy efficiency of the product.

One of the most popular choices is UPVC. UPVC is a very affordable material that is easily available. It is very durable and has a lifespan of around 35 years. UPVC can be recycled seven times, making it an environmentally friendly choice. Contrary to timber, UPVC doesn't degrade over time.

Using uPVC as an alternative to timber is smart. It's much more affordable and you don't need to worry about maintaining. A UPVC replacement window will provide the appearance of an old-fashioned wooden sash window in the event that you know what to expect from.

There are numerous reasons to replace your windows including security, safety, and comfort. Windows are a very important component of a home for a large number of people. Making the investment in newwindows that are energy efficient will not only lower your expenses, but can increase the value of your property. If you've recently bought an apartment or are trying to sell it, you could discover that installing new windows can increase the value of your home.

Timber sash windows could be considered to be the traditional window. However they require a lot of care and attention. In time, they will become less durable and energy efficient. They must be maintained and cleaned frequently.

Modern uPVC solutions are available. Modern uPVC technology can help you build an inviting and warm house while keeping your energy bills low. In the most recent models, there are a variety of products that are designed to look and function as wooden windows.

The best part is that you don't need spend a lot for a product that will last a lifetime. Depending on the style and materials you choose, uPVC sash windows can cost anywhere between PS500 to PS800.
